Education has evolved dramatically over the past few decades, driven by rapid advancements in digital innovation. One of the most significant developments in modern education is the adoption of Classroom technology, which has transformed traditional teaching methods into interactive, engaging, and highly effective learning experiences.
From smart boards and digital whiteboards to tablets, educational software, and virtual learning platforms, Classroom technology enables teachers to deliver lessons more efficiently while helping students learn in a dynamic environment. As educational institutions continue to embrace digital transformation, classroom technology has become an essential component of modern learning.
Classroom technology refers to the digital tools, devices, software, and systems used to enhance teaching and learning processes. These technologies help educators present information in innovative ways while allowing students to interact with content more effectively.

One of the greatest advantages of Classroom technology is its ability to capture students' attention. Interactive lessons, videos, animations, and educational games make learning more enjoyable and engaging.
Visual and interactive content helps students understand complex concepts more easily, leading to better retention and improved academic performance.
Every student learns differently. Classroom technology allows teachers to present information through text, audio, video, and interactive activities, accommodating various learning preferences.
Digital tools encourage students to participate in discussions, quizzes, and collaborative projects, making learning more interactive and student-centered.
Smart boards are among the most popular forms of Classroom technology. They allow teachers to write, draw, display multimedia content, and interact with lessons directly on a touchscreen display.
Portable devices provide students with access to educational resources, online research materials, and digital assignments.
LMS platforms help educators manage lessons, assignments, assessments, attendance, and communication in one centralized system.
Video conferencing technology supports remote learning and enables virtual classrooms, allowing students and teachers to connect from anywhere.
Specialized software applications help students develop skills in mathematics, science, language learning, coding, and other academic subjects.
Classroom technology makes it easier for students to collaborate on projects, share ideas, and work together regardless of their physical location.
Digital learning resources can be accessed anytime and anywhere, making education more flexible and inclusive.
Technology helps teachers organize lesson plans, track student progress, automate administrative tasks, and communicate effectively with students and parents.
Advanced educational platforms can adapt content based on individual student performance, creating personalized learning experiences.
Technology-rich classrooms help students develop digital literacy and technical skills that are increasingly important in today's workforce.

The initial investment required for purchasing devices, software, and infrastructure can be significant for some institutions.
Teachers need adequate training to integrate technology effectively into their teaching methods.
Internet outages, software glitches, and hardware failures can occasionally disrupt learning activities.
Educational institutions must protect student data and ensure secure use of digital platforms.
The future of Classroom technology is being shaped by innovations such as artificial intelligence, augmented reality, virtual reality, and adaptive learning systems. These technologies are expected to create even more immersive and personalized educational experiences.
AI-powered learning platforms can provide instant feedback, while virtual reality can transport students into interactive simulations that enhance understanding. Cloud-based collaboration tools will continue to support hybrid and remote learning environments.

The FD is responsible for protection and conservation of biodiversity and sustainable management of forest resources of the country. It performs the protection and production functions in harmony, based on the Forest Policy (1995). While endeavoring to mitigate climate change through sustainable forest management, FD has been making its best efforts to meet the basic needs of local people.
